/* ------------------ UNIVERSAL TAGS ----------------- */
body {
	background-color: #fefffe;
	background-image: url('images/bbbkgd2.jpg');
	background-repeat: repeat;
	margin-left: 38px;
	margin-top: 22px;
	margin-right: 38px;
	margin-bottom: 10px;
}
p { margin-top:0px; margin-bottom:12px; line-height:120%; }
a { color:#005588; text-decoration:none; }
a:hover { color:#b08002; tcursor:pointer; text-decoration:underline; }
form,input,select,textarea {margin:0;padding:0;font:12px Arial,Helvetica,sans-serif;}
/* --------------------------------------------------- */

/* ------------- SITE NAV FORMATTING ------------- */
div.menwrap {background-color:#004000; padding:20px; border:3px solid #0c5c7c;} 
div.submenu {font-size: 12px; font-family:verdana,arial; border-top:1px solid #fcfcfc; border-bottom:1px solid #fcfcfc; display:block; position:relative;}
div.submenu a {color: #fcfcfc; text-decoration:none; padding:2px 8px 2px 8px; display:block; font-weight:bold;}
div.submenu a:link {color: #fcfcfc; background-color:#673612; text-decoration: none;}
div.submenu a:visited {color: #fcfcfc; background-color:#673612; text-decoration: none;}
div.submenu a:hover {color: #fcfcfc; background-color:#995604; text-decoration: none;}
div.submenu a:active {color: #fcfcfc; text-decoration: none;}

div.submenuon {font-size: 12px; font-family:verdana,arial; border-top:1px solid #fcfcfc; border-bottom:1px solid #fcfcfc; display:block; position:relative; background-color:#309010;}
div.submenuon a {color: #fcfcfc; background-color:#309010; text-decoration:none; padding:2px 8px 2px 8px; display:block; font-weight:bold;}
div.submenuon a:link {color: #fcfcfc; background-color:#309010; text-decoration: none;}
div.submenuon a:visited {color: #fcfcfc; background-color:#309010; text-decoration: none;}
div.submenuon a:hover {color: #fcfcfc; background-color:#309010; text-decoration: none;}
div.submenuon a:active {color: #fcfcfc; background-color:#309010; text-decoration: none;}


/* ------------- GENERIC TEXT FORMATTING ------------- */
.bodytext_xxs { font-family: Arial, Helvetica, sans-serif; font-size: 11px; font-style: normal; font-weight: normal; color: #000000; }
.bodytext_xs { font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-style: normal; font-weight: normal; color: #000000; }
.bodytext_s { font-family: Arial, Helvetica, sans-serif; font-size: 13px; font-style: normal; font-weight: normal; color: #000000; }
.bodytext { font-family: Arial, Helvetica, sans-serif; font-size: 13px; font-style: normal; font-weight: normal; color: #000000; }
.copy { font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-style: normal; font-weight: normal; color: #000000; }

.bodytext_l { font-family: Arial, Helvetica, sans-serif; font-size: 15px; font-style: normal; font-weight: normal; color: #000000; }
.bodytext_xl { font-family: Arial, Helvetica, sans-serif; font-size: 16px; font-style: normal; font-weight: normal; color: #000000; }
.bodytext_xxl { font-family: Arial, Helvetica, sans-serif; font-size: 18px; font-style: normal; font-weight: normal; color: #000000; }
.bold {font-weight:bold;}
/* --------------------------------------------------- */


/* ------------- SPECIAL TEXT FORMATTING ------------- */
/* margin/padding values:  top right bottom left */
.pageheading { font-family: Arial, Helvetica, sans-serif; font-size: 24px; font-style: normal; font-weight: bold; color: #ffffff; }
.sidecolblue { font-family: Arial, Helvetica, sans-serif; font-size: 15px; font-style: normal; font-weight: bold; color: #005699; }
.sidecolblue h4 { font-size: 18px; }
.footer { font-family: Arial, Helvetica, sans-serif; font-size: 14px; font-style: normal; font-weight: bold; color: #99c1da; }
.star { font-size: 20px; font-weight: bold; color: #f00000; }
a.textnav {color:#559900; text-decoration:underline; font-size:12px; font-family: arial}
div.side_bg_fade {
	background-image: url('http://wenetwork.com/images/templates/bluefade_bg.jpg');
	background-repeat: no-repeat;
}
.contid {font-family: Helvetica,verdana,Arial,sans-serif; font-size: 14px; font-style: normal; font-weight:600; color: #673612; margin: 0 0 0 0; padding: 2px 0 6px 20px;}
.qresulth { font-family: Arial; font-size: 12px; font-style: normal; font-weight: bold; color: #000022; }
.qresult { font-family: times roman; font-size: 12px; font-style: normal; font-weight:500; color: #0000aa; }
.tmain { border-top:0px solid #200000; border-bottom:0px solid #200000; border-right:4px solid #200000; 
	border-left:4px solid #200000; width:786px;}
.tdmain { padding:0px 12x 0p 12px; vertical-align:top;}
/* --------------------------------------------------- */


/* ------------- HEADER TEXT FORMATTING ------------- */
/* margin/padding values:  top right bottom left */
h1 { font-family: Arial, Helvetica, sans-serif; font-size: 22px; font-style: normal; font-weight: bold; color: #a73612; margin: 0 0 0 0; padding: 4px 0 10px 0; }
h2 { font-family: Arial, Helvetica, sans-serif; font-size: 18px; font-style: normal; font-weight: bold; margin: 0 0 0 0; padding: 2px 0 6px 0; }
h3 { font-family: Arial, Helvetica, sans-serif; font-size: 15px; font-style: normal; font-weight: bold; margin: 0 0 0 0; padding: 1px 0 3px 0; }
/* --------------------------------------------------- */

/* ------------- DEFINE LIST FORMATTING ------------- */
/* margin/padding values:  top right bottom left */
dt { font-family: Helvetica,verdana,Arial, sans-serif; font-size: 19px; font-style: normal; font-weight:bold; color: #c73612; margin: 0 0 0 0; padding: 4px 0 10px 0; }
dd { font-family: Helvetica,verdana,Arial,sans-serif; font-size: 15px; font-style: normal; font-weight:600; color: #104000; margin: 0 0 0 0; padding: 2px 0 6px 20px; }
/* --------------------------------------------------- */
